CHG: help text changes in cmdlfjablotron.c

CHG: increase byte size to uint16_t in crc.c CRC16Legic
This commit is contained in:
iceman1001 2016-07-29 20:58:52 +02:00
commit 514ddaa2ff
3 changed files with 16 additions and 12 deletions

View file

@ -99,8 +99,8 @@ uint32_t CRC8Legic(uint8_t *buff, size_t size) {
uint32_t CRC16Legic(uint8_t *buff, size_t size, uint8_t uidcrc) {
#define CRC16_POLY_LEGIC 0xB400
//uint8_t initial = reflect(uidcrc, 8);
uint16_t initial = uidcrc;
uint16_t initial = reflect(uidcrc, 8);
//uint16_t initial = uidcrc;
initial |= initial << 8;
crc_t crc;
crc_init_ref(&crc, 16, CRC16_POLY_LEGIC, initial, 0, TRUE, TRUE);